In 1912, Vera Allifair Cain entered the world in Oakway, Oconee, South Carolina, United States, born to Aaron Verba Cain And Sylvester Lou Anna Gibson. In 1920, Vera Allifair Cain resided in Hopewell, Anderson, South Carolina, USA. Vera Allifair Cain married Earl Russell Spurlock, and had children including Alice Faye Spurlock, Anna Louise Spurlock, Carrie Linda Spurlock, Debra Kay Spurlock, Earl Russell Spurlock Jr, Edward Jackson Spurlock, Mamie Sue Spurlock, Margaret Ann Spurlock, Olga Ruth Spurlock, Rachel Icelene Spurlock, Sammy Joe Spurlock, Wilbur Athon Spurlock. Vera Allifair Cain passed away in 1963 in Greenville, Greenville, South Carolina, USA.
